A "Natural Step" as Tahir Bashir Rejoins Aberdein Considine's Renowned UK Recoveries Department
Award-winning Lender Services practice also welcomes new Senior Associate
UK law firm Aberdein Considine LLP has further reinforced its award-winning Lender Services division with two more senior appointments.
Tahir Bashir has rejoined the firm’s Lender Services Practice Group as Senior UK Recoveries Operations Director after sharpening his skills in the broader sector, while experienced repossession conveyancing lawyer Susan Robinson joins as a Senior Associate.
Their appointments come hot on the heels of fellow Lender Services colleagues Victoria-Louise Maugham, Head of Unsecured Recovery, and Sarah Phelps, Senior Associate, joining Aberdein Considine last month.
Tahir has built up more than 25 years’ experience in property and debt recovery, having first joined Aberdein Considine in May 2020 from Ascent Performance Group.
Since September 2025, he has gained further valuable experience leading teams within another law firm and a major American bank. His decision to come back to Aberdein Considine, which he describes as a “natural step”, makes him the second senior AC ‘returnee’ in under a week after commercial litigation specialist Leonie Nimmons rejoined the firm as a Consultant in Dispute Resolution, based in Aberdeen.
Susan brings over two decades’ experience as a conveyancing solicitor, having most recently held the role of Legal Underwriter at Premier Property Lawyers.
